智能语音识别软件,也被称为自动语音识别(ASR),是一种技术,它能够将人类的语音转化为文本。这种技术在许多领域都有广泛的应用,包括客户服务、翻译、教育等。
智能语音识别软件的工作原理是通过分析语音信号的特征,如音调、语速、语调等,来识别说话者的意图和内容。这个过程通常包括以下几个步骤:
1. 预处理:首先,对输入的语音信号进行预处理,包括噪声消除、回声消除、增益控制等,以提高语音信号的质量。
2. 特征提取:然后,从预处理后的语音信号中提取特征,这些特征可以包括频谱特征、波形特征、韵律特征等。
3. 声学模型:接下来,使用声学模型来预测语音信号的概率分布。这个模型通常基于大量的训练数据,通过机器学习算法来学习语音信号的特点。
4. 语言模型:然后,使用语言模型来预测语音信号的下一个词或短语。这个模型通常基于语言学知识,如词汇、语法等。
5. 解码:最后,根据声学模型和语言模型的结果,使用解码器来生成文本。解码器通常是一个神经网络,它可以学习语音信号和文本之间的映射关系。
智能语音识别软件的优点在于其准确性和效率。与传统的语音识别方法相比,智能语音识别软件可以更快地处理大量语音数据,并且可以更好地处理各种口音和方言。此外,智能语音识别软件还可以支持多种语言和方言,使其在全球化的应用中具有优势。
然而,智能语音识别软件也有一些挑战。例如,语音信号的复杂性和多样性使得语音识别的准确性受到限制。此外,语音识别系统的训练需要大量的标注数据,这可能会增加系统的计算成本。
总的来说,智能语音识别软件是一种强大的技术,它可以帮助我们理解和处理人类的语言。随着技术的不断发展,我们有理由相信,未来的智能语音识别软件将会更加准确、高效和易用。